HomeMy WebLinkAboutCity Council Resolution 1991-766RESOLUTION NO. 91-766 RESOLUTION RELATING TO GENERAL OBLIGATION PARK IMPROVEMENT BONDS OF 1980: CALLING BONDS FOR REDEMPTION AND PREPAYMENT: AUTHORIZING THE ISSUANCE AND SALE OF GENERAL OBLIGATION REFUNDING BOND (SPECIAL SERIES 1992) BE IT RESOLVED By the City Council of the City of Plymouth, Minnesota (City) : Section 1. Background: Findings. 1.01. The City has issued and sold its $2,950,000 General Obligation Park Improvement Bonds of 1980 (Prior Bonds), dated May 1, 1980. The Prior Bonds mature serially on February 1, in the years 1992 through 1996, both inclusive. The outstanding balance of the Prior Bonds is $1, 500, 000. The Prior Bonds maybe called for prepayment and redemption on February 1, 1992 ( Call Date) and on any interest payment date thereafter. 1.02. It is found and determined that there are on hand in City Fund 403 (Utility Trunk Fund) adequate monies that can be made available to provide funds to redeem and prepay the Prior Bonds on the Call Date. 1.03. Pursuant to the Section 475.61, Subdivision 1 Act the resolution awarding the sale of the Prior Bonds levied ad valorem taxes (Taxes) on all taxable property in the City to pay when due the principal of and interest on the Prior Bonds. Section 475.61, Subdivision 4 of the Act authorizes the City to use the proceeds of the Taxes to repay advances tvde by other City funds used for payments of principal of and interest on bonds for which the Taxes were levied. 1.04. It is further found and determined that pursuant to Section 475.67 of the Act that the City may issue and sell its general obligationw bonds and that pursuant to Minnesota Statutes 471.56, such refunding bonds a proper Investment for available City funds. 1.05. It is further found and determined that it is in the best financial interests of the City and its sound financial management that: (a) the Prior Bonds be called for redemption on the can Fate; (b) funds to redeem and prepay the Prior Bonds be made available from City Fund No. 403; (c) the City issue and sell its General Obligation Refunding Bonds (Special Series 1992) (Refunding Bond) to refund the Prior Bonds; and (d) City Fund No. 403 purchase the Refunding Bonds. 0=4877 nioo-u9 Sec. 2. Authorization: Directions. 2.01 The Prior Bonds are called for redemption and prepayment on February 1, 1992. The Clerk is authorized and directed to publish the Notice of Call in substantially the form attached hereto as Exhibit A and to send copies of the notice to the paying agent for the Prior Bonds and to the Original Purchaser of the Prior Bonds. 2.02. The City will issue and sell the Refunding Bonds to City Fund No. 403 at a price of par.
